CI note for Quartzline contractors: the bloom-filter sidecar in front of KestrelKV occasionally reports false-negative rates above threshold during the nightly suite. This is almost always a stale filter snapshot, not a hashing bug. Re-run the seed job, then retry the failing stage once. If it fails twice, the filter bitmap was likely truncated by the cache warmer; file a ticket with the artifact attached. Include the trace token printed below when filing.

pipeline stamp: htk21_104c5ba7d0df6b2897cd5

If the feed goes stale, first check the sensor gateway health dashboard; most outages are caused by the gateway dropping its uplink after a power blip. Restarting the `occufeed` service clears about 90% of incidents. Do not adjust calibration values without approval from the facilities data team. Known issues and workarounds are tracked in the repo wiki. For anything the runbook doesn't cover, contact the feed maintainers.

escalation mailbox, fawep-tahop: quenvan@nelvrostack.internal

The GC pause fix looks directionally right, but the matcher in Dunmere still allocates short-lived candidate arrays per tick, so you're treating symptoms. Fine for now — file a follow-up. Two asks: document why the pause target is set where it is, and confirm the survivor sizing against the soak run, since the last tune regressed tail latency. Approving once comments land. Constants under review are these.

constants for tageg-kagag:
QUOTAS = {
    "kelax": 495,
    "istath": 366,
    "tammir": 108,
    "novdor": 730,
    "casax": 816,
    "quenael": 874,
    "pelius": 403,
}